The island

Where to stay in Saint Lucia

Each region has its own rhythm, mood, and kind of magic.

South-West

Wake up beneath the Pitons before the island gets loud.

Volcano, hot springs, cacao farms, and the island's most dramatic landscape.

South Coast

Where fishermen meet the sunrise.

Empty beaches, quiet mornings, and local life before the day begins.

East Coast

The quiet Saint Lucia most travelers never meet.

Micoud, local rituals, morning roads, and raw Atlantic beauty.

Village sectors

South and east communities I love to build around.

These are the places where the journey can become more personal: morning roads, fishing villages, local kitchens, waterfalls, markets, music, and the rhythm of everyday Saint Lucia.

Vieux FortSouthern gateway, markets, community stories, Black Bay, and real local rhythm.
LaborieSoft beach mornings, fishing life, village walks, and slower coastal days.
MicoudEast coast beauty, Latille Falls, quiet roads, local rituals, and hidden nature.
DenneryMusic, fish, east coast culture, village energy, and the sound of Saint Lucia.
